This info is a week old.

Aug 10 .. fished near the green coast guard bouy, 9A I think. From 19:30 to dark. We got 50 or so big fattie herring for the live bait tank.

Aug 11 .. fished by the OSU marine docks and there were bazillions of anchovies on the surface. Not expecting this and the only reason I found them is they were jumping. Right at first light. We got 200 or so greenbacks.

Any slack tide when the tide is running hard and most of any incoming tide when the tide is not so big. You will find bait in the bay all summer. Use your electronics and the birds are very helpful too.

Good luck. Oh .. we used Sabikis with green beads, no krystalflash and small white wings. Most were on the bottom but as I said use the plastic Hey zuess on the dash board to find them.

I went yesterday from 9 till 3pm, I had 18 shad, anout 6 herring (large) and a handfull of dinks. It could change overnight, but pretty darn slow.

WHAT was pretty cool was the huge school off anchovies, every year there are some and generally they are dinks, but these are the biggest i have seen in Npt. They were as big as my fat fingers and probably 7".

I caught a bunch of them, but they don't freeze very well.
